Saskatchewan government defeats opposition paid sick leave bill
May 17, 2022The government of Saskatchewan has voted against legislating paid sick leave for workers in Saskatchewan, in response to a sick leave bill introduced by the opposition that would have provided up to 14 days of paid sick leave.
The province’s labour minister expressed concern for the added cost burden on businesses this bill would have resulted in, especially following the announcement of the government’s intention to raise minimum wage from $11.81 to $15 over the next 29 months.
